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ibm-sw-tpm2: 1332 -> 1563 #77112

Merged
merged 1 commit into from Jan 7, 2020
Merged

ibm-sw-tpm2: 1332 -> 1563 #77112

merged 1 commit into from Jan 7, 2020

Conversation

@r-ryantm
Copy link
Contributor

@r-ryantm r-ryantm commented Jan 6, 2020

Semi-automatic update generated by https://github.com/ryantm/nixpkgs-update tools. This update was made based on information from https://repology.org/metapackage/ibm-sw-tpm2/versions.

meta.description for ibm-sw-tpm2 is: '"IBM's Software TPM 2.0, an implementation of the TCG TPM 2.0 specification"'.

meta.homepage for ibm-sw-tpm2 is: '"https://sourceforge.net/projects/ibmswtpm2/"

Checks done (click to expand)
Rebuild report (if merged into master) (click to expand)

26 total rebuild path(s)

9 package rebuild(s)

9 x86_64-linux rebuild(s)
9 i686-linux rebuild(s)
0 x86_64-darwin rebuild(s)
8 aarch64-linux rebuild(s)

First fifty rebuilds by attrpath
discover
fwupd
gnome-firmware-updater
gnome3.gnome-software
ibm-sw-tpm2
plasma5.discover
tpm2-abrmd
tpm2-tools
tpm2-tss

Instructions to test this update (click to expand)

Either download from Cachix:

nix-store -r /nix/store/cx5l9r6g1rc32ylqw1q97qgnzyrxal0i-ibm-sw-tpm2-1563 \
  --option binary-caches 'https://cache.nixos.org/ https://r-ryantm.cachix.org/' \
  --option trusted-public-keys '
  r-ryantm.cachix.org-1:gkUbLkouDAyvBdpBX0JOdIiD2/DP1ldF3Z3Y6Gqcc4c=
  cache.nixos.org-1:6NCHdD59X431o0gWypbMrAURkbJ16ZPMQFGspcDShjY=
  '

(r-ryantm's Cachix cache is only trusted for this store-path realization.)

Or, build yourself:

nix-build -A ibm-sw-tpm2 https://github.com/r-ryantm/nixpkgs/archive/ef1b0467b0d857d8a892e2c331ed334270b0a88d.tar.gz

After you've downloaded or built it, look at the files and if there are any, run the binaries:

ls -la /nix/store/cx5l9r6g1rc32ylqw1q97qgnzyrxal0i-ibm-sw-tpm2-1563
ls -la /nix/store/cx5l9r6g1rc32ylqw1q97qgnzyrxal0i-ibm-sw-tpm2-1563/bin

cc @delroth for testing.

@delroth
delroth approved these changes Jan 7, 2020
Copy link
Contributor

@delroth delroth left a comment

LGTM, checkPhase of dependent packages still passes (and afaik that's the only real use case for this package).

@ryantm ryantm merged commit 4ad9f21 into NixOS:master Jan 7, 2020
16 checks passed
16 checks passed
ibm-sw-tpm2 on x86_64-darwin No attempt
Details
Evaluation Performance Report Evaluator Performance Report
Details
grahamcofborg-eval ^.^!
Details
grahamcofborg-eval-check-maintainers matching changed paths to changed attrs...
Details
grahamcofborg-eval-check-meta config.nix: checkMeta = true
Details
grahamcofborg-eval-darwin n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./pkgs/top-level/release.nix -A darwin-tested
Details
grahamcofborg-eval-nixos n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./nixos/release-combined.nix -A tested
Details
grahamcofborg-eval-nixos-manual n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./nixos/release.nix -A manual
Details
grahamcofborg-eval-nixos-options n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./nixos/release.nix -A options
Details
grahamcofborg-eval-nixpkgs-manual n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./pkgs/top-level/release.nix -A manual
Details
grahamcofborg-eval-nixpkgs-tarball n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./pkgs/top-level/release.nix -A tarball
Details
grahamcofborg-eval-nixpkgs-unstable-jobset nix-instantiate --arg nixpkgs { outPath=./.; revCount=999999; shortRev="ofborg"; } ./pkgs/top-level/release.nix -A unstable
Details
grahamcofborg-eval-package-list nix-env -qa --json --file .
Details
grahamcofborg-eval-package-list-no-aliases nix-env -qa --json --file . --arg config { allowAliases = false; }
Details
ibm-sw-tpm2 on aarch64-linux Success
Details
ibm-sw-tpm2 on x86_64-linux Success
Details
@r-ryantm r-ryantm deleted the r-ryantm:auto-update/ibm-sw-tpm2 branch Jan 13, 2020
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Linked issues

Successfully merging this pull request may close these issues.

None yet

3 participants
You can’t perform that action at this time.